If you press the "Filter" button without enrtering items or non-items, the scripts generate this URL:
https://www.diablofans.com/builds?filter-has-spell-2=-1&filter-build-tag=3&filter-has-item=undefined&filter-no-item=undefined&filter-class=128
The red error Messages get generated because 2 Params are defined as "=undefined" . If you alter the URL manually by removing "undfined" like this:
https://www.diablofans.com/builds?filter-has-spell-2=-1&filter-build-tag=3&filter-has-item=&filter-no-item=&filter-class=128
the resulting Display is fine.
